Contractor Update: Do Employees Need To Carry Proof of Working for a Critical Sector Business?
Construction “of all kind” has been listed as a Critical Sector and exempt under the recent Stay at Home order issued by Minnesota Governor Tim Walz on March 25, 2020 (“Stay at Home Order”). Based on this, construction employees may continue to leave...
